[QUOTE="sithijawijesinghe, post: 1612972, member: 28625"] No, I didn't mean GPRS here. What I want to know is that is there any way which we could use the mobile phone as an interface for the PC to get connected to the net. I got this crazy idea when i installed a bluetooth device into the pc. then there was a new connection named 'Bluetooth Dial Up Network connection' automatically created in network connections folder. and also there was a bluetooth DUN modem & a bluetooth fax modem dirvers installed into the system. will I be able to connect my phone to the pc via bluetooth and then go online using it? if so, then what should the ISP be. can I use any ISP available in srilanka? how fast the speed would be be?
